the cruise itself was perfect... perfect weather, perfect company, etc. food was good, lines were manageable.

Arrived in port at 5am to learn that our flights were canceled, and we spent several hours calling car rental agencies to find a one-way rental to drive to Ohio. Found a Dollar Merc Grand Marquis... great battleship to drive home. Cost $450 for one day's drive!

And a hint to non-nyc people... departing from the NYC cruise terminal, after you exit from US Customs, you will see several burly gentlemen standing just outside the entryway, hawking 8 passenger limo rides to the airport car rental. Sounded good to us, as it was about the same price as a cab ride for the four of us.
